You’re tracking your decisions. Good.

But you’re not learning from them.

A decision journal without analysis is a diary. It tells you what happened. It doesn’t tell you why, or what to do differently next time. The pattern is always the same: you log a choice, review it weeks later, and think "that was obvious." Then you make the same type of suboptimal decision again three months later.

This is the gap. Not between journaling and not journaling. Between recording and understanding.

Here’s what changes:

  1. You get pattern recognition at scale. Your brain is terrible at statistical self-analysis. It’s great at anecdotes and confirmation bias. An AI system sees the 50 decisions, not just the last one. It shows you that your "gut feel on hiring" has a 40% accuracy rate, while your "structured process for vendor selection" hits 78%. That’s not an insult. It’s a targeting system for improvement.
  1. You surface cognitive biases in real-time. Not after the fact. When you log a decision and the system flags "this matches your pattern of optimism bias in resource allocation," you can pause. You can add a constraint. You can ask one more question. The bias doesn’t disappear, but you see it operating.
  1. You create feedback loops that actually close. The gap between "intended outcome" and "actual result" isn’t just a column in a spreadsheet. It’s a learning signal. When the system can show you that decisions made in the first hour of your workday have a 30% better outcome rate than those made after 4 PM, that’s not a journal entry. That’s a schedule optimization.
